Satellites are equipped with a variety of sensors that allow them to observe a wide range of targets, making them versatile tools for gathering geospatial intelligence. The ability to observe Earth and other satellites encompasses a broad spectrum of observations including terrestrial features, human infrastructure, environmental changes, and celestial bodies.

When observing Earth, satellites can capture images and data of landscapes, urban areas, water bodies, and even phenomena like climate change. They can also monitor the activities of other satellites in orbit, which is important for space traffic management and ensuring the safety of operations in space.
